STARLIGHT CONTINUES TO VAMP UP THE
BRISBANE PROFESSIONAL THEATRE SCENE

When the Schonell Theatre closed its doors as a cinema venue earlier this year, Brisbane based theatre company Starlight Productions took it upon themselves to re-launch the Schonell as a contemporary hot spot for live professional theatre.

Now, following the runaway success of their debut production of the RENT, Starlight Musical Theatre is continuing that quest with their latest venture, the Broadway smash hit Godspell.

Conceived and originally directed by John-Michael Tebelak, with music and new lyrics by Stephen Schwartz, “Godspell” is one of the biggest off-Broadway and Broadway successes of all time. Based on the Gospel According to St. Matthew, and featuring a sparkling score by Stephen Schwartz, “Godspell” boasts a string of well-loved songs, led by the international hit, “Day By Day.” Drawing from various theatrical traditions “Godspell” is a groundbreaking and unique reflection on the life of Jesus, with a message of kindness, tolerance and love.

Under the direction of award winning actor/ director Jack Bradford, Godspell features a showcase of hot Brisbane talent including seasoned actors such as Matilda Emerging Artist award nominees Michael Balk, Dirk Hoult and Judy Hainsworth.

Director Jack Bradford says what makes Godspell such a crowd pleaser is its ability to balance hilarious comedy and meaningful drama in a format that leaves so much to interpretation.
“You can pretty much take the foundations of the show and build your own Godspell from the ground up to make it relevant to any era,” he says.
“Audiences will love the romp-roaring comedy and the way the actors jump into the audience at every opportunity and play and sing with them. They make the pace and the rhythm of the comedy come alive. Godspell is not just a play, it’s an experience.”
Bradford says the success of Godspell would mean Starlight could continue to build quality theatre with contemporary professional shows in 2007.
“RENT was a big jump for Starlight! At that point we were supported by Schonell management, but now we are on our own,’
“We need to continue to communicate to the new Schonell management that we need support and focus that will allow a more long term approach to great theatre at the Schonell.”
